Credit Card Fraud Analyst jobs in Portland, ME

Credit Card Fraud Analyst monitors suspicious transaction activities and resolves fraudulent activities. Contacts merchant and cardholders to verify charges and prevent loss. Being a Credit Card Fraud Analyst requires a high school diploma or equivalent.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. The Credit Card Fraud Analyst works under moderate supervision. Gaining or has attained full proficiency in a specific area of discipline. To be a Credit Card Fraud Analyst typically requires 1-3 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    Fraud Specialist

    The Fraud Specialist is responsible for conducting account research for potential fraud, determining accountability and notification process. You will be utilizing multiple systems and tools to gather relevant data to create detailed summaries of events and articulate findings. Identify and highlight potential fraud to appropriate departments, following within the Credit Union procedures.

    Delivers excellent service to members and other departments while assisting with requests, questions, and concerns regarding deposit and loan accounts. Reviews accuracy and completeness of account documents; generates and reviews information and resolves exceptions.

    Requirements:

    The successful applicant will be a highly motivated, team oriented, positive thinker with a desire to provide exceptional service in a fast-paced environment. You should have three to five years of similar or related experience. Working knowledge of Credit Union systems and platforms is beneficial for this position. Some of the responsibilities of this position are as follows:

    • Monitor and analyze transaction data, member accounts, and other relevant information to identify and investigate unusual or suspicious behavior.
    • Conduct in-depth investigations into suspected fraud, gather evidence and document your findings.
    • Work with and train various departments on fraud related
    • Stay up to date on industry trends, emerging threats, and best practices for fraud prevention. Use data and detection tools to identify patterns and trends.

Portland is a city in the U.S. state of Maine, with a population of 67,067 as of 2017. The Greater Portland metropolitan area is home to over half a million people, more than one-third of Maine's total population, making it the most populous metro in northern New England (an area comprising the states of Maine, New Hampshire, and Vermont). Portland is Maine's economic center, with an economy that relies on the service sector and tourism. The Old Port district is known for its 19th-century architecture and nightlife.
